The Single-Player Experience: Redefining the War Story
The Single-Player campaign of Call of Duty 2 is often cited as one of the finest in the genre's history. Unlike its predecessor, which utilized a standard health bar and medkit system, Call of Duty 2 popularized the regenerating health mechanic. At the time, this was a revolutionary design choice. It removed the frustration of saving the game with only "one hit point" left, allowing the developers to craft relentless, overwhelming set pieces without fearing that the player would be stuck in an unwinnable state. This shift fundamentally changed the pacing of FPS games, encouraging players to play aggressively rather than tentatively peeking around corners.
The narrative structure abandons the perspective of a single protagonist, instead offering a triptych of campaigns: the British, the American, and the Soviet. This structure allows the player to witness the war from diverse angles, moving from the scorching sands of the North African campaign with the British "Desert Rats," to the chaotic D-Day landings at Pointe du Hoc with the American Rangers, and finally to the ruined streets of Stalingrad with the Red Army.
The game’s AI was also a significant leap forward. Enemies no longer simply ran at the player or stood still; they utilized flanking maneuvers, took cover dynamically, and tossed grenades to flush the player out. The "Battle Chatter" system—where NPCs shouted warnings, orders, and panic-stricken cries based on the player's actions—added a layer of immersion that made the battlefield feel alive. The Multi-Player Component: The Birth of a Phenomenon
While the campaign was critically acclaimed, the Multi-Player (MP) aspect of Call of Duty 2 laid the foundation for the modern competitive shooter. On the PC platform, CoD 2 became a staple of competitive gaming, particularly in Europe. It stripped the multiplayer down to the basics of aim, movement, and map knowledge.
The movement mechanics—specifically "gun hopping" or "bounce"—became legendary. Unlike modern shooters that penalize players for jumping or shooting while moving, CoD 2 allowed for fluid, ballistic movement. A skilled player could leap around a corner, aim down sights in mid-air, and secure a kill. This high skill ceiling distinguished the game from its contemporaries.
Furthermore, the modding support on PC was robust. The "Promod" community thrived, stripping the game of visual clutter (like smoke and foliage) to create a clean, sterile competitive environment reminiscent of Counter-Strike. Single-Player (SP): Three Fronts, One War
The single-player campaign offers 27 missions across three distinct campaigns, allowing you to experience the war from the perspective of Allied soldiers:
The Soviet Campaign: Start as Private Vasili Koslov in the defense of Stalingrad, featuring brutal urban combat and impressive snowstorm levels.
The British Campaign: Follow the "Desert Rats" across the sands of North Africa and later into Caen, France, featuring the return of the iconic Captain Price.
The American Campaign: Begin with the explosive storming of Pointe du Hoc on D-Day and push through the German Rhine to the war's conclusion. Key SP Features:
Regenerating Health: Abandoned traditional med-packs for a system that keeps the action fast-paced and cinematic.
Battle Chatter: A revolutionary context-sensitive system where squadmates shout warnings, call out enemy positions, and coordinate movements.
High Intensity: Missions are gameplay-centric with minimal filler, delivering a constant stream of set-piece battles. Multiplayer (MP): Classic Combat
Even decades after release, the Call of Duty 2 multiplayer scene remains active, often supported by dedicated communities and mods.
Game Modes: Includes classic types such as Deathmatch, Team Deathmatch, Search & Destroy, Capture the Flag, and Headquarters.
Player Capacity: PC servers can host up to 64 players, offering large-scale tactical battles.
Global Settings: Battles take place across Normandy, North Africa, and Russia, with teams split between the Allies and the Axis.
Pure Gunplay: Lacks modern "perks" or killstreaks, focusing instead on recoil management, positioning, and raw shooting skill. PC System Requirements

Because Call of Duty 2 was released in 2005, modern systems (Windows 10/11) often need a few tweaks to run the Single Player (SP) and Multiplayer (MP) modes correctly. Multiplayer Black Screen Fix:
Navigate to your main Steam folder (e.g., C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am). Copy Steam.dll and Steam2.dll. Paste them into your Call of Duty 2 installation folder.
Right-click CoD2MP_s.exe, go to Properties > Compatibility, and set it to Windows XP (Service Pack 3). Field of View (FOV) & Fullscreen: Enable the console in Game Options. Press ~ and type cg_fov 90 to increase your visibility.
If the game won't stay in fullscreen, find your config.cfg file and ensure seta r_fullscreen is set to "1".
Performance: For a smoother experience in MP, users often remove the 91 FPS cap by setting com_maxfps 0 in the config_mp.cfg file. 2. Single Player (SP) Walkthrough
